Townhouse Application&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
A flat is a project whose drawing-model pair can be referred to from an active project. The drawing-model pair of a flat project can be added to the active project as a reference drawing-model pair. You cannot edit the flat project in the project to which you added it, but you need to open it for editing using a separate function. For example, flats can be used for planning terraced houses or blocks of flats by using a separate project for each flat in a terraced house or each floor in a block of flats.</description>
